Is it possible for fibre optic cable with a probe assembly to detect temperature like a digital thermometer?

Also, would fibre optic technology increase accuracy over conventional metal core cable?

Yes, there is a group of temperature-measuring devices, known as radiation thermometers (or more frequently radiation pyrometers) which includes types in which the signal is transferred to the signal conditioning and display unit through a fibre optic cable. These are particularly suitable where access is very limited or the environment unsuitable for solid state components - amplifiers etc.

These instruments depend on the fact that all objects emit thermal radiation over a wide range of frequencies or wavelengths according to the Planck radiation law. By selecting the operating wavelength, the useable temperature range may vary from ambient temperatures up to very high temperatures.

One advantage of a fibre optic cable in this instance is that it does not require an interface to an electrical temperature sensor such as a thermocouple or a resistance thermometer. The working end of the cable is formed into a blackbody cavity, so that the thermal radiation transferred down the cable approximates Planck's law reasonably accurately.
